The Gospel of Matthew is the first of the Gospels and is the first book of the New Testament. For centuries it was thought that this gospel was the first to be written and was always given pride of place. Scholars no longer believe that it was the first written but recognize its important place in the canon of Scripture. It is much darker than the other Gospels, with the shadow of the Cross falling across it, and it is told through the eyes of Saint Joseph.
